David, I have little interest in keris that are outside the core keris culture area of Jawa-Bali, however if I apply the way in which keris in these areas were classified by the people who taught me, the scabbard & hilt that I'm looking at here would be given as Bugis, the blade would be given as "diluar Jawa" outside Jawa, which is understood as "it doesn't really matter". That's Jawa keris thought, not keris collector thought.
Now, Adam has said "whole kit & caboodle", I understand that as the entire keris, ie, the keris that we see before we remove the blade from the scabbard.
So looking at this entire keris, I really cannot see anything other than a keris that falls within the spread of Bugis culture.
The blade?
Well, that is "outside Jawa".
When somebody can tell me exactly where, outside Jawa, & why from that specific place, I'll certainly listen and take note.
